Ira gives up presents to provide WN cash boost

FRIENDS and family who gave cash instead of gifts for Ira Bowman's 60th birthday have helped her to present cheques totalling £720 to the West Norfolk branch of the Alzheimer's Society.

"Everyone was very generous and the local branch was thrilled," said Mrs Bowman, who was 60 on December 8.

"I chose the Alzheimer's Society because my mother suffered from the illness before she died last January and I know how terrible it can be for families. It also made a difference knowing that the money will go directly to the local branch of the Society."

Mrs Bowman, who lives in Spring Close, Gaywood, was joined by her daughters Justine and Claire Bowman and her grandchildren, Betsy and Poppy Stainsby, for the presentation to the branch chairman, Ralph Brewster, and other officials.
